The Effect of Mandala Art Therapy Applied Before Cesarean Section on Surgical Fear and Cortisol Levels in High-Risk Nulliparous Women: A Randomized Controlled Trial

研究概览

简要总结

This randomized controlled study aims to evaluate the effect of mandala art therapy applied before cesarean section on surgical fear and cortisol levels in high-risk pregnant women. Participants will be randomly assigned to intervention and control groups. The intervention group will receive mandala art therapy prior to surgery, while the control group will receive standard care. Surgical fear levels and salivary cortisol levels will be measured to assess the outcomes.

详细描述

This randomized controlled trial is designed to investigate the effect of mandala art therapy applied in the preoperative period on surgical fear and cortisol levels in high-risk nulliparous women scheduled for cesarean section. The study will be conducted with participants meeting inclusion criteria and randomly assigned to intervention and control groups using a randomization method.

The intervention group will receive a structured mandala art therapy session prior to cesarean section, while the control group will receive routine preoperative care. Surgical fear levels will be assessed using a validated scale, and physiological stress will be evaluated through salivary cortisol measurements. The primary outcome of the study is the change in surgical fear levels, while the secondary outcome is the change in cortisol levels. Data will be analyzed using appropriate statistical methods to determine the effectiveness of the intervention.

入选标准

  • The study sample will consist of high-risk nulliparous women scheduled for elective cesarean section on the same day. Participants will be included if they are 18 years of age or older, diagnosed with high-risk pregnancy conditions (e.g., preeclampsia, gestational diabetes, placenta previa, oligohydramnios, etc.), at term pregnancy (37-42 weeks gestation), with a singleton pregnancy, and able to understand and complete the data collection forms.

排除标准

  • Women with a diagnosed psychiatric disorder, any condition that impairs communication (such as hearing, visual, or language impairments), those receiving systemic corticosteroid therapy, those with endocrine disorders that may affect cortisol levels, and those with active oral lesions such as aphthous ulcers or other oral mucosal lesions will be excluded from the study.

研究组 & 干预措施

Control Group

No Intervention

Pregnant women in this group will receive routine preoperative care without mandala art therapy.

Mandala Art Therapy Group

Experimental

Participants allocated to the intervention group will receive mandala art therapy in addition to standard preoperative care before cesarean section. The intervention will consist of a single structured mandala coloring session lasting approximately 30-45 minutes and will be administered prior to surgery. The intervention is intended to reduce preoperative surgical fear and psychological stress.
